With the new locking gas cap, only time will tell if this proceeds to be a problem. KTM has made a marginal effort to bandaid this issue. A good company would have completely changed the design to eliminate all opportunities for failure. The funniest thing is that the 1/4 turn cap was marketed as a quick-refill cap for racing. Now, the locking version takes two hands and lots of effort to get off.

I'm not trying to spread bad publicity about KTM. I'm only trying to inform you of a still potential issue. The bad thing is with '08 bikes, there is no tank replacement option unless the aftermarket companies release one soon.
